The difference in the measures of two complementary angles is 42 . Find the measures of the angles.

Answer:

The angles are 24° and 66°.

Step-by-step explanation:

Let two angles be x and y.

For two complementary angles,

x+y = 90 ...(1)

ATQ,

x-y = 42 ...(2)

We need to find the measures of the angles.

Add equation (1) and (2).

x+y+x-y = 90+42

2x = 132

x = 66

Put the value of x in equation (1)

66+y = 90

y = 90-66

y = 24

So, the angles are 24° and 66°.
